Application of nucleoside analogue labelling to study the cell cycle of xenografted PDAC cell lines in the chorioallantoic membrane model.
The chorioallantoic membrane (CAM) model is an underutilised alternative model for the research into tumour xenografts.
The chorioallantoic membrane (CAM) model is an underutilised alternative model for the research into tumour xenografts. We demonstrate that in the pancreatic cancer cell lines BxPC-3 and AsPC-1, nucleoside labelling with 5-ethynyl-2'-deoxyuridine (EdU) can be multiplexed with…
